Objective

Form as many words as possible by linking adjacent hexagon tiles, using each tile only once per word, until you use up all of the letters.

Playlin'sGuide

Hexaboo is a daily word puzzle game built around a honeycomb of letters where your mission is to form as many words as possible using adjacent tiles.

You're presented with a hexagonal grid of letter tiles. Tap connected letters to spell words. Each tile can only be used once per word, and letters must touch to link together. Certain letters score more points, like in Scrabble.

  • Tap through adjacent hexagonal tiles to form words.
  • Each letter can only be used once per word.
  • Tiles must be connected to count.
  • Daily Hexaboo offers a full sized puzzle that resets every day.
  • Daily Mini-Boo gives you a smaller, quicker challenge.
  • Endless Hexaboo is available anytime for practice or warm up.
